LOOK] TRAINING ON GENDER AND DEVELOPMENT MAINSTREAMING AND THE HARMONIZED GENDER AND DEVELOPMENT GUIDELINES (HCDG)
GOLDEN LACE FINE DINING, COTABATO CITY
JULY 11-12, 2023
Mainly, the 2-days training aimed at improving the Gender Mainstreaming in the implementation of programs, projects and activities of the Ministry; and HGDG.
It was facilitated by an external trainer, a gender specialist and a member of the Resource Pool of the Philippine Commission on Women.
The following topics were thoroughly presented and discussed:
1. Introduction to Gender Mainstreaming Evaluation Framework (GMEF) to help the participants increase understanding on the processes and context of gender mainstreaming within an organization or agency; help them acquire a holistic view of the (gender) mainstreaming process; and guide them in assessing their progress in gender mainstreaming.
2. Harmonized Gender and Development Guidelines to help participants` recognize concepts and tools developed for integrating gender concerns into programs and activities, to ensure that programs and projects to be carried out are gender responsive.
3. Brief Orientation on GAD Planning and Budgeting process to properly guide the participants on the elements and process of planning and budgeting.
4. Group workshop on GAD Planning and Budgeting for 2024
5. Presentation of responsive GAD Plan and Budget- each sector has presented their Plan and Budget for 2024 that reflects how they will address gender issues and concerns in their respective sector or division.
